aboutsummaryrefslogtreecommitdiffstats
path: root/dln.c
diff options
context:
space:
mode:
authorNobuyoshi Nakada <nobu@ruby-lang.org>2022-07-17 08:59:20 +0900
committerNobuyoshi Nakada <nobu@ruby-lang.org>2022-07-17 09:01:33 +0900
commit50cfecd0155236a3120c5f78b779b058867cb46d (patch)
tree5f5eb4003c8b5a0755a2c740eed345e1a80c4eba /dln.c
parent5ae83151b16858083e6443fadc76e7fde0ff1199 (diff)
downloadruby-50cfecd0155236a3120c5f78b779b058867cb46d.tar.gz
Show ABI incompatible binary path
Diffstat (limited to 'dln.c')
-rw-r--r--dln.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/dln.c b/dln.c
index a31cbf936f..b9cfe7dc94 100644
--- a/dln.c
+++ b/dln.c
@@ -456,7 +456,7 @@ dln_load(const char *file)
unsigned long long (*abi_version_fct)(void) = (unsigned long long(*)(void))dln_sym(handle, "ruby_abi_version");
unsigned long long binary_abi_version = (*abi_version_fct)();
if (binary_abi_version != ruby_abi_version() && abi_check_enabled_p()) {
- dln_loaderror("ABI version of binary is incompatible with this Ruby. Try rebuilding this binary.");
+ dln_loaderror("incompatible ABI version of binary - %s", file);
}
#endif